AgentiveAIQ is a no‑code platform specifically designed for businesses that need a fully branded, AI‑powered chatbot without writing a single line of code. Its standout WYSIWYG chat widget editor lets resort owners drag and drop design elements, adjust colors, logos, fonts, and layout, ensuring the chatbot blends seamlessly with the resort’s website or mobile app. Beyond visual customization, AgentiveAIQ offers a dual knowledge base that combines Retrieval‑Augmented Generation (RAG) for fast, document‑based fact retrieval and a Knowledge Graph that understands relationships between concepts, allowing the bot to answer nuanced questions about room types, spa services, or local attractions. The platform also supports hosted AI pages and AI courses—ideal for resorts that want to provide interactive training for staff or educational content for guests. Long‑term memory is available only for authenticated users on hosted pages, giving guests a personalized experience while keeping anonymous widget visitors in a session‑only mode. The platform’s modular prompt engineering framework includes over 35 snippets and nine goal modules, enabling quick tailoring to specific resort functions such as booking assistance, concierge services, or loyalty program management. AgentiveAIQ’s pricing is transparent: a Base plan starts at $39/month for two chat agents and 2,500 messages; a Pro plan at $129/month includes eight agents, 25,000 messages, a million‑character knowledge base, five secure hosted pages, and long‑term memory for authenticated users. The Agency plan at $449/month scales to 50 agents, 100,000 messages, ten million characters, 50 hosted pages, and full branding options. Dialzara is a voice‑first automation platform aimed at businesses that need to handle phone calls and messaging across multiple channels. Its core strength lies in its ability to provide automated phone answering services, allowing resorts to offer 24/7 customer support without hiring additional staff. The platform supports real‑time routing of calls, automated responses to common inquiries, and seamless handoff to live agents when needed. Dialzara’s pricing starts at $199/month for the Asksuite package, which is tailored for multichannel chatbot usage, primarily focusing on direct bookings and customer engagement. While the platform is more focused on voice and phone integration, it also offers a web-based chatbot that can be embedded on a resort’s website. Pros include robust voice automation, real‑time call routing, and the ability to handle high‑volume call traffic. Cons are that the platform is primarily voice‑centric, lacking in-depth knowledge base management, and its pricing can be higher for smaller resorts that do not require extensive phone support.

HelloTars offers an AI‑powered chatbot builder that focuses on creating conversational experiences through a visual interface. The platform’s key features include a drag‑and‑drop agent builder, a knowledge base for storing FAQs and documents, and live chat handover capabilities for transferring conversations to human agents. It also includes analytics and reporting tools that allow resorts to track engagement metrics, conversation flows, and performance of their chatbot. HelloTars’ pricing model is not explicitly disclosed in the provided research, so interested users should contact the team for a custom quote. The platform is well‑suited for resorts that want a straightforward, visual chatbot creation process and robust analytics but may not need advanced knowledge graph or RAG functionalities. Voiceflow is a platform that enables creators to design, prototype, and launch conversational experiences across voice and chat channels. Its workflow builder allows users to design complex conversation flows without coding, while the knowledge base feature supports generating AI content for dynamic responses. Voiceflow also offers an agent content manager for organizing and managing bot assets. The platform is geared toward developers and designers who want to build conversational AI for voice assistants, chatbots, or connected devices. While Voiceflow’s research does not detail pricing, the platform typically offers tiered plans that could suit small to medium resorts. Key strengths include robust workflow design, cross‑platform compatibility, and a community of developers. However, Voiceflow lacks a dedicated no‑code visual editor for chat widgets and does not provide e‑commerce or knowledge graph integrations, which may limit its appeal for resorts looking for deep knowledge integration.

ChatBot.com is a well‑known chatbot platform that offers a visual builder, pre‑built templates, and AI integration for creating conversational agents. The platform’s strengths lie in its ease of use, extensive template library, and integration with popular messaging platforms like Facebook Messenger, Slack, and WhatsApp. Pricing starts at $50/month for the Starter plan, which includes 500 interactions per month and basic analytics. For resorts, ChatBot.com can quickly deploy a chatbot for FAQs, booking assistance, and guest engagement. However, the platform lacks advanced knowledge graph capabilities and deep RAG features, which means the bot’s responses may rely more on scripted flows than dynamic knowledge retrieval.
